No idea what it is? 'Snapchat' is an application, I have it through Google's Play Store for Android (For my HTC Desire S). Its a free to download app that lets you send messages to contacts in the form of pictures/photos/SNAPSHOTS. Best thing is, its free to send, no more paying for Multimedia text messages (MMS)! The app works like this, you take a picture/snap, you can draw on the picture or have a word text message to go with it (if you want either) and then you send it to one of your 'Snapchat' contacts. The unique thing about 'Snapchat' is that when you send an image, you can set a timer for its availability, for example I would send a snap for 4 seconds, the recipient only has 4 seconds of viewing time, after which, they can't view the snap again, unless I resent it.
